Abstract:
The fourth Industrial Revolution is stimulating a fast-paced and resilient industrial internet of things (IIoT) ecosystem. Blockchain, a decentralized digital ledger technology, plays a crucial role in improvising, securing, and streamlining traditional biotechnology-related industrial processes with IoT and creates a sustainable nexus between social, economic, and environmental aspects.
